BC Gaming: NCAA Football 09 Review

Available hot routes/audibles and coaching options cement a solid play-calling system. Players can choose basic plays, delve into a more detailed playbook or just let the coach make the call. Different situations will trigger different player reactions. Coaches can also boost specific player performance during breaks; for example, by boosting your secondary with a four-deep defense while coaching the defensive line. Those evade movements achieved by shaking the remote are pretty satisfying as well as the resulting defensive pressure.

EA does another fine job creating something special for the Wii console version of this sports game (could a PC version be on the horizon?). This recommended game features the Michigan State Spartan mascot on the cover.
